Norėdami pašalinti vieną laikiną kintamąjį, kurį sukūrėte naudodami veiksmą SetTempVar, "Access" darbalaukio duomenų bazėse galite naudoti makrokomandos veiksmą RemoveTempVar.
Parametras
Makrokomandos veiksmas RemoveTempVar turi šį argumentą.
Veiksmo argumentas |
Aprašas |
Pavadinimas |
Įveskite laikinojo kintamojo, kurį norite pašalinti, pavadinimą. |
Pastabos
-
Vienu metu galite nustatyti iki 255 laikinų kintamųjų. Jei nepašalinsite laikino kintamojo, jis liks atmintyje, kol uždarysite duomenų bazę. Baigę naudoti laikinuosius kintamuosius, naudinga juos pašalinti.
-
Kai uždarote duomenų bazę ar projektą, "Access" automatiškai pašalina visus laikinus kintamuosius.
-
Jei klaidingai įrašysite šalintinų kintamųjų pavadinimus, "Access" nerodys klaidos. Norimas pašalinti kintamasis liks atmintyje, kol uždarysite duomenų bazę.
-
Jei sukūrėte daugiau nei vieną laikiną kintamąjį ir norite juos visus pašalinti iš karto, naudokite veiksmą RemoveAllTempVars .
-
Norėdami vykdyti veiksmą RemoveTempVar VBA modulyje, naudokite objekto TempVars metodą Remove.
Pavyzdys
Ši makrokomanda parodo, kaip sukurti laikiną kintamąjį, naudoti jį sąlygos ir pranešimo lauke, tada pašalinti laikiną kintamąjį naudojant veiksmą RemoveTempVar .
Sąlyga |
Veiksmas |
Argumentai |
Nustatytitempvar |
Vardas: MyVar Išraiška: InputBox("Įveskite ne nulinį skaičių.") |
|
[Laikiniejivarai]! [MyVar]<>0 |
MsgBox |
Pranešimas: ="Įvedėte " & [TempVars]! [MyVar] & "." Pyptelėjimas: Taip Tipas: informacija |
RemoveTempVar |
Vardas: MyVar |